By Dave Brower, Meadowlands Handicapper — Early Double Analysis — Friday, July 16, 2021

Race 1

1              BOUNTY HUNTER – First crop Huntsville colt that brought $100K at the sale. He’s off to very good start, and in crafty hands here. First foal of the mare. They could be onto something here. Take a good, long look out on the track.

2              FOXHUNT – First of three for the Alagna Armada. He’s gone pretty fast so far, but maybe lacking that winning habit just yet? That could come. Todd has done good job of educating him. The speed is there, so consider that.

3              NAVIGATOR – Hate to see that miscue in very first real start. So, let’s expect a few changes to try and right the ship.

4              GREG THE LEG – Interesting name for a horse! Like #2, he’s come along nicely, but has yet to show that killer instinct. That’s hard to teach. But, I like to see some speed and no mistakes. They tried couple stakes. This is a drop. Needs it.

5              RIVER NESS – You hate to see those sick scratches with the youngsters, especially out of stakes races. Usually means something’s not right. So, what should we expect tonight? I’m not really sure. This is pretty good bunch for overnight.

6              PEBBLE BEACH – We haven’t seen too many Downbytheseaside’s yet here in NJ, but they’re killing it out in Ohio. He was a supremely-talented pacer! Had a really tough trip in first stakes event. May need a little more seasoning.

7              CAVIART CAMDEN – Has come a long way, pretty quickly too! After that initial miscue, he’s just getting better and better. Yannick put a real nice trip on him here a few weeks ago. Nice mark right off the bat! 51.4. No 12-1 tonight.

8              QUICK SNAP – Here’s a Betting Line second foal of the mare. So, Alagna has all kinds of sires in his barn. This guy flashed improved speed AND finish in just that second go around. Obviously has talent. Let’s see how much.

DRIVER CHOICES:

Dexter Dunn 3 over 8

Todd McCarthy 6 over 2

Top Contenders  7-2-1-8

Race 2

1              STAMPED BY LINDY – Didn’t look overly ready for his first real assignment. They were probably aiming at the consolation anyway. The first start showed major promise. I guess I’d be surprised if we didn’t see LOT more tonight.

2              JACK RABBIT SLIMS – Picked up checks in both preliminary rounds. That’s a good thing! He didn’t have a ton of punch late, but he’s coming to his natural speed. I like what I’ve seen so far. This is perfect spot to step up with more.

3              SOUTHWIND ARTURO – I’ll have to keep this guy on the longshot list for now. A “work in progress” for Burke.

4              WALL OF MONI – Raced okay in the Geers. That’s a good solid start. Then miscued in the only sires stakes try, so that’s a step backward. All these Walner’s have been great so far. I expect this colt to bounce back big tonight. Watch for it.

5              BRIGHT SIDE UP – They’re taking their time with this well-bred son of Muscle Hill and that’s okay! Some horses just take a little longer than others. He’s been finishing okay. One night soon, we’ll see more speed.

6              HIGH HILLS – Sports a real mixed bag of efforts so far, but they won’t rush this guy either. He’s got way too much pedigree and many from this family have taken time to mature. I’m willing to wait, and watch for the signs.

7              LAWS OF MOTION – Andy took a very aggressive stance with this fella last time and the colt just couldn’t stay with that monster late stages. Still, he made no mistakes. The speed was there. I think he’ll get better as we go along.

8              FEAST DAY – Two good starts. Two bad starts. A rough post tonight will hurt. I imagine the Captain will try to baby him around there and let him finish again. No mistakes, please.

DRIVER CHOICES: None

Top Contenders  4-2-7-1
